Course Content

• Rocket Engine Thrust Fundamentals
• Thermodynamic Cycles for Rocket Propulsion
• Combustion Processes in Rocket Engines
• Nozzle Design and Performance (Rocket Engine Thrust Optimization)
• Propellant Chemistry and Handling
• Rocket Engine Testing and Evaluation
• Advanced Rocket Engine Concepts
• Rocket Engine Control Systems
• Failure Analysis and Reliability in Rocket Propulsion
